Charles A. Ray

Charles Aaron Ray (born 1945) finished his 50-year career of public service in 2012 as the U.S. Ambassador to Zimbabwe. He is a former Foreign Service Officer and career member of the Senior Foreign Service who held the position of U.S. Ambassador twice, and retired with the rank of Minister-Counselor. He is also a retired U.S. Army officer who was decorated twice for his actions in combat during the Vietnam War, and later served as the Deputy Assistant Secretary of Defense for POW/Missing Personnel Affairs.
==Early life, education, and military service==
Born in Center, Texas, Ray earned his Bachelor's degree from Benedictine College in 1972, his Master of Science from the University of Southern California, and his second Master of Science from the National Defense University.
Ray joined the United States Army in 1962 and retired 20 years later with the rank of major.〔〔 During his time with the Army, he served in Vietnam (1968–1969, 1972–1973), Germany, Okinawa, and South Korea.〔〔 In the course of his 20-year Army career, he earned two Bronze Stars and an Armed Forces Humanitarian Service Medal.〔
